Robert Buckhout is a scholar working on Social Psychology, Cognitive Neuroscience and Law. According to data from OpenAlex, Robert Buckhout has authored 29 papers receiving a total of 465 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 10 papers in Social Psychology, 6 papers in Cognitive Neuroscience and 4 papers in Law. Recurrent topics in Robert Buckhout’s work include Memory Processes and Influences (6 papers), Deception detection and forensic psychology (6 papers) and Jury Decision Making Processes (3 papers). Robert Buckhout is often cited by papers focused on Memory Processes and Influences (6 papers), Deception detection and forensic psychology (6 papers) and Jury Decision Making Processes (3 papers). Robert Buckhout collaborates with scholars based in United States. Robert Buckhout's co-authors include Thomas H. Kramer, Michael Beer, Milton W. Horowitz, Daniel J. Weintraub and Milton J. Rosenberg and has published in prestigious journals such as Science, Journal of Personality and Social Psychology and American Psychologist.
